What to Look for in a Sportsbook

A sportsbook is a bookmaker that takes bets on athletic events and pays out winnings. Generally, they offer a variety of betting options on sporting events such as baseball, football, and hockey. They may also offer wagers on politics, fantasy sports, and esports.

The most important thing to look for in a sportsbook is the odds. They are usually displayed on a sign and they indicate how much a bet will pay out. Those odds are based on the probability of an event happening.

Most sportsbooks use a computer program to handle the odds. Some have their own software while others work with a specific company that provides the program.
